BQCL Membership Benefits

Your BQCL membership benefits include:

  • Eligibility to enroll in any of our programs such as soccer, martial arts, basketball, playschool, tennis (program fees are required for each program)
  • Reduced rental rates at the BQCL hall
  • Use of the BQCL tennis courts
  • Free skating on any outdoor community league rink (always take along your skate tags)
  • Free indoor skating at Confederation, Kinsmen, Millwoods, Southside & Tipton arenas
  • Free Swimming at Confederation Pool (Saturdays from 4-7pm). Phone: 780-944-7402. Note:  Confederation Pool will be closed for annual maintenance until Oct. 15, 2011.

Our Mission Statement

"The Blue Quill Community League strives to provide a sense of community, and to
enhance the quality of life in our neighbourhood by providing facilities for community use; excellent social, recreational and cultural programs; and focused advocacy efforts."
